Re: P910i alarm clock
On Thu, 3 Mar 2005 10:14:41 +0200, "DON" <[email protected]> wrote:
>why must phone be turn on for alarm clock?
>is there another way?
I guess that's just the way it's made.
If you want to use the alarm, but not have the phone disturbing you, put it in
flight mode before you sleep.
